I used to like celery. I bought a juicer at the thrift store one time and made celery juice, celery and cucumber juice, celery and apple juice.
They were all good.
Now, a glass of celery juice would cost $5 to make at home.
Bad weather and a food fad promoting the benefits of celery juice have pushed the price of celery at major Canadian grocery stores to anywhere between $4.47 to $5.99 for a single bunch.
I might as well buy it at the refreshments bar of an upscale fitness center.
Not that I'd ever go inside one of those places.
So, the juicer stays in the storage shed.
